Web10 minuten geleden · New York, April 14, 2024 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- According to Market.us, The global electron microscope market is estimated to be valued at USD … Web7 jul. 2024 · Electron microscopy uses electrons to “see” small objects in the same way that light beams let us observe our surroundings or objects in a light microscope. With EM, we can look at the feather-like scales of an insect , the internal structures of a cell, individual proteins or even individual atoms in a metal alloy.
